    This thing puts out good amounts of power (I'm running it in only a 3.1 configuration, so it has spare capacity), and runs cool, which I really like. The Onkyo TX-SR607 it replaced ran so hot -- all the time -- that I actually kept a laptop cooler fan on top of it because I was worried it was going to die if I didn't. The Bluetooth pairing is hassle-free, as is the auto-calibration. This thing looks good and is easy to use (much more intuitive than my Onkyo was).

    Solid system for a bedroom or mid to small room but lacks functions of more expensive units. It does the job and has enough power but you can't dial in the speakers very much compared to some others. I find myself frustrated with speaker calibration often. There is some light adjustment but it's just the frequency and decibel level. There's also no option for different settings to switch between such as movies, games, or music. You have to manually go through menus and change each individual setting each time to get quality sound. There isn't like a selectable preset you can program and switch between. Auto calibration is really bad too. It sounded like an elevator speaker system and had to completely change every speaker setting after calibration. This system replaced an older Yamaha unit that failed after 12yrs but had better sound with lower power output and much better adjustability. Mostly disappointed in this one but it works well enough as a bedroom unit. If you just want surround sound and tweak it a lot on setup you'll be fine. If you want easy adjustability between sound inputs (movie, music, games, etc), you'll be disappointed having to manually change every speaker every time or living with one setting that does not fit all. Next time I'll go to a higher end unit.
